This is an average Chinese restaurant in the outskirts of Limassol.

The restaurant is located near Kourion and Kolossi and great if you want to go to the beach or return with a take-away. It also has very beautiful indoor seating with an aquarium and very friendly service. The food is average, just like most of Chinese places in Cyprus.

The menu has all standard Chinese dishes, like dim sum soup, sweet and sour pork, duck etc. It's the same as in other Chinese restaurants in Limassol.

Mr Guys Thai Chinese is one of the restaurants reviewed on Foodie.cy.

The restaurant Mr Guys Thai Chinese is a small Limassol Asian restaurant focused on takeaway, delivery and easy casual meals. Reviews describe it as friendly and practical rather than fancy, with a compact space and a menu built around familiar Thai and Chinese comfort food.

The menu The dishes that come up most often are pad thai, duck, fried rice, chicken dishes, soups, spring rolls and prawns. Positive reviews mention good prices, quick service and satisfying takeaway meals. Negative ones point to occasional misses with tougher beef or uneven execution, so this is not a guaranteed fine-dining Asian meal.

The Noodle house is one of the restaurants reviewed on Foodie.cy.

The restaurant is located in the Old Town of Limassol, close to the Marina. It's decorated in authentic Japanese style with the wooden interior. It has an open kitchen with most of the dishes prepared on the wok. The service is quite fast and very polite. There's no parking nearby, so try to find a space before reaching the Old Town.

The menu is a great blend of Chinese, Japanese and Thai cuisine. You'll find most traditional dishes there, like Peking Duck, which is gloriously presented to you hanging from the ceiling above the kitchen, or Ramen soups, or a plentiful of Wok dishes, or tasty sushi. They also have a great and relatively inexpensive cocktail card. They have dine-in and takeaway options with some discounts, so a lot of office workers nearby eat their lunches there.

Wagamama Limassol Marina is one of the restaurants reviewed on Foodie.cy.

The restaurant is located in the picturesque Marina of Limassol. Outside dining tables offer a great view over the yachts parked nearby. The interior is nothing fancy, just some wood and glass. The service is OKish, it might be a bit slow sometimes during the peak lunch hours.

The menu mostly consists of the Japanese dishes like sushi, rolls, bowls, donburi, ramen and rice. In addition to this they have some Chinese fried noodles and some Thai dishes, too.
